Sudden Joint Pain

The onset of sudden joint pain can indicate many different things, so it is therefore important to take a long and careful look at all of the possibilities as to what it could be. The first explanation of this kind of pain is osteoarthritis, and it is a very common joint disorder that millions of people around the world experience. Although there is no known central cause of this condition, it is closely tied in with aging, however there are still genetic and chemical factors which play a part as well. The symptoms of this kind of condition usually appear in those who are middle-aged, and a majority of people who are upwards of 70 years old have them.

  • Experiencing this type of sudden pain in this area of the body could also mean that you are overworking your body with too much physical activity of some sort. If you have a job that involves constantly using your body and putting strain on the muscles and joints, then that could be one possibility. Those people who work in construction are more likely than others to have problems with sudden joint pain, although there are many other occupations where these type of sudden injuries are common.

  • Fracturing of the hip as a result of too much pressure placed on the bone can lead to a sudden feeling of pain in this area as well. If the bone punctures through the skin and it visible, then it is said to be a compound fracture, a very serious injury that must be dealt with right away. Leaving it untreated you risk infection and much more serious health problems as a result. These kind of fractures can result from anything like a car accident, falling from a great height, or repeated physical activity such as running. Even though this type of exercise is good for you, putting too much pressure on the muscles and joints can result in pain.

  • If your sudden joint pain still seems like a mystery, then you will also want to consider the possibility of tendonitis. It is essentially an inflammation or swelling of a tendon in the body. Your tendons make up the connection between the muscle and bone of your body. This condition can result from either minor or severe injuries, over-stimulation, or simply aging. Along with old age comes many unpleasant health problems, including arthritis and the wearing away of tendons, bone, and muscle. All of these things can cause a sudden pain in the joints.

  • Although it usually sets in over time and from an early age, rheumatoid arthritis is another reason you may be feeling pain in your joints. It is a condition which lasts for years and causes the joints to become inflamed as well as the tissues that surround the area. While it is a bit more rare, the organs in the body can also be effected by this type of inflammation. Although doctors and scientists alike do not have an official cause of rheumatoid arthritis figured out, there are theories that involve genetics and certain environmental factors as well.

  • Lupus, an autoimmune disease, could also be the culprit of your sudden joint pain. This is basically a condition where the body’s immune system begins to fight itself instead of outside infections like it should. The immune system begins to blur the lines between healthy types of substances and unhealthy ones, so the ability to fight off bacteria and toxins is extremely limited. Although it is considered to be a fairly rare condition, it is still a possibility that you may want to consider. It is best to get an official diagnosis from a physician who is licensed and can give you treatment options for whatever you may have that is causing this pain to occur.
